I take my son to My Gym at Great World city for play gym classes. Its right next door to us so its very convenient. They also have just expanded so they have other kinds of classes like music and playgroups.
School is still the best way for him to find friends, you can enrol him at preschool or montessori. Alot of them take kids from 18mtns. I'll be sending my son who is only 16 mtns now to Brighton montessori at river valley in Jan. Its for him to learn how to socialise without me around. Allow him to be more independent.
Dont worry, when you settle here you'll find lots of activities to keep your son occupied esp at that age when its easier to take him around. Theres alot of playgrounds around. You can even form one yourself!

How's Tuesday? 1pm...at a kids playplace?
Someone on here mentioned they go to Great World City Shopping Center to a place called My Gym. They have 'Open Gym' time from 1230-200 on Tuesday for kids to climb, jump, bounce, etc. It's abt 20$. It's not super-exciting but my 3 year old really liked it and there's plenty of things to keep them busy. There were a couple 6-7 yr old kids there that seemed to be having fun too.
Anyone who is interested in meeting...see you there!
Great World City
1 Kim Seng Promenade (Orchard area)
#03-06/07/08/09/10
(There's an elevator near the McDonalds on the bottom floor. It's on the same floor as the Cinema. Next to "Grace Kids". ...and the entrance to the Gym is at the back of a party supply store called Jolly-something???)
From Orchard MRT station take bus 16 or 175 OR theres a free "Great World City" Shuttle bus that takes you to the mall.
